2011-09-19 81 views
0

我有一點關於vimrc文件位置的複雜問題。我在Windows上使用gvim/vim。我試圖找到vimrc文件的位置。 「:版本」 顯示下列數據: 用戶:$ HOME/_vimrc 系統:$ VIM/vimrc裏 $ HOME:C:\用戶\ XYZ $ VIM:C:\ Program Files文件(x86)的\ VIMvimrc文件,viminfo文件

我試圖搜索「$ HOME/_vimrc」。我找不到。所以,我做了:e $ MYVIMRC和系統「vimrc」。現在我想知道vim是如何從系統文件夾中獲取「vimrc」的,以及爲什麼沒有用戶「vimrc」文件。

但是,viminfo文件正在用戶文件夾中更新。 「$ HOME/_viminfo」

感謝

回答

2

用戶的vimrc(或_vimrc,你的情況),默認情況下不會在$ HOME目錄中創建。它被用作系統vimrc配置的覆蓋。

如果您創建該文件,則可以覆蓋系統vimrc配置文件。

+0

專業。這是有道理的。 viminfo需要爲每個用戶分開。所以,它會爲每個用戶單獨創建。但是,只要用戶不想創建自己的vimrc,就會使用相同的vimrc。 –